Weather in March

March, the first month of the autumn in Challambra,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 14.6°C (58.3°F) and 25.6°C (78.1°F).

Temperature

March's onset corresponds with a subtle shift in the average high-temperature, slightly moving from a warm 29.2°C (84.6°F) in February to a still moderately hot 25.6°C (78.1°F). An average low-temperature of 14.6°C (58.3°F) marks the nights in Challambra throughout March.

Humidity

In Challambra, the average relative humidity in March is 55%.

Rainfall

The months with the least rainfall are February and March Rain falls for 8.3 days and accumulates 15mm (0.59") of rain.

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day in Challambra is 12h and 19min.
On the first day of March, sunrise is at 7:15 am and sunset at 8:08 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:42 am and sunset at 7:25 pm AED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in March in Challambra is 8.5h.

UV index

In March, the average daily maximum UV index in Challambra is 5.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
